Variables Influencing Emergency Situation Dental Expenses



When taking into consideration emergency dental expenses, various factors can dramatically impact the final amount you may need to pay. One important aspect is the intensity of your dental problem. Minor troubles like a broken tooth may set you back much less contrasted to a more complex emergency like a root canal.

The timing of your emergency can also influence the price. Looking for assistance during normal office hours might be less expensive than needing prompt focus beyond common working hours.

Your place contributes too. Urban areas tend to have higher oral costs than rural areas because of distinctions in overhead expenditures. The specific dentist you choose can likewise impact the final bill. A lot more experienced or customized dental experts might charge greater charges for their services.

Additionally, the need for any kind of analysis examinations, medications, or follow-up visits can contribute to the overall cost.

To manage emergency dental expenses, it's necessary to know these factors and think about looking for treatment without delay to prevent more complications that could increase the last costs.

Common Emergency Dental Procedures and Costs



Emergency dental solutions frequently include procedures such as extractions, fillings, and root canals, each with varying linked prices. Extractions, where a tooth is eliminated, can range from $75 to $450 per tooth depending on the intricacy. Dental fillings, utilized to deal with tooth cavities, commonly expense between $100 to $300 per filling. https://www.health.com/the-9-best-whitening-toothpastes-of-2023-or-tested-by-health-7484465 , a procedure to treat infected tooth pulp, might range from $500 to $1500 per tooth.

For broken teeth, the price can differ from $100 to $1000 depending upon the intensity. Oral crowns, utilized to cover damaged teeth, normally cost between $500 and $3000 per tooth. Repairing a broken tooth may vary from $100 to $1000.

Keep in mind that these costs can change based on factors like the dental professional's know-how, place, and the complexity of the treatment. Tips for Managing Emergency Oral Costs



To better browse unexpected dental expenses, consider carrying out useful techniques for taking care of emergency oral costs successfully. To start with, make certain to have oral insurance coverage or an oral cost savings strategy in place. These options can help in reducing the economic problem of emergency situation treatments.



Furthermore, some dental professionals provide in-house funding or payment plans, which can make it less complicated to cover the expenses in time.

One more pointer is to discover different therapy alternatives with your dental professional. In some cases, there may be a lot more affordable options that still address your oral emergency effectively. It's likewise necessary to prioritize your dental health and wellness to prevent future emergency situations.

Regular oral examinations and practicing excellent oral health can help avoid costly emergency situation treatments over time.
